#63a461 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63a461 is composed of 38.8% red, 64.3%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.9%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 118.2 degrees, a saturation of 26.9% and a lightness of 51.2%. #63a461 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ffc2 with #004900.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#63a461 color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#63a461 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63a461 has RGB values of R:99, G:164,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 6530145.
